Class: BerkeleyLibrary::TIND::Export::RowMetrics

Inherits:
Object
  • Object
show all
Defined in:
lib/berkeley_library/tind/export/row_metrics.rb

Instance Attribute Summary collapse

Instance Method Summary collapse

Constructor Details

#initialize(formatted_row_height, wrap_columns) ⇒ RowMetrics

Returns a new instance of RowMetrics.



7
8
9
10
# File 'lib/berkeley_library/tind/export/row_metrics.rb', line 7

def initialize(formatted_row_height, wrap_columns)
  @formatted_row_height = formatted_row_height
  @wrap_columns = wrap_columns
end

Instance Attribute Details

#formatted_row_heightObject (readonly)

Returns the value of attribute formatted_row_height.



5
6
7
# File 'lib/berkeley_library/tind/export/row_metrics.rb', line 5

def formatted_row_height
  @formatted_row_height
end

Instance Method Details

#wrap?(col_index) ⇒ Boolean

Returns:

  • (Boolean)


12
13
14
# File 'lib/berkeley_library/tind/export/row_metrics.rb', line 12

def wrap?(col_index)
  @wrap_columns.include?(col_index)
end